Default good way to get paint scuff off car?

some idiot parked near me at work and scuffed my passenger's side door with white paint, its not bad but need a good buffing compound as I will be removing it by hand.

Get some Meguiars Scratch-X and give that a try. It's a mild polishing compound and will probably take several passes to make much difference, but you'd have a hard time damaging the paint with it.
